As an Admission Counselor, you'll work with high school students and families, delivering presentations, executing events, analyzing data, and helping prospective students navigate one of the most important decisions of their lives. You'll travel throughout your assigned territory, represent Illinois College at schools and community events, review applications, and partner with colleagues to achieve shared enrollment goals. Along the way, you'll gain real-world experience in consultative sales, marketing, public speaking, project management, and strategic decision-making.

Essential Functions:

The following list of duties is meant to be representative of the work performed in this position. The omission of a specific duty or responsibility will not preclude it from the position if the work is similar, related or a logical extension of position responsibilities.

Counsel prospective students and their families as they seek to learn about the value of an Illinois College education.

Act as Territory Manager for an assigned region within the US to realize an assigned recruitment goal.

Meet weekly goals for counselor initiated completed contacts. Respond to in-person, phone and electronic admissions inquiries in a timely manner and at times that are appropriate for different time zones.

Review applications for admission and scholarships

Assist with on-campus, off-campus, and virtual recruiting events and conduct information sessions.

Conduct follow-up with prospective students at times that are convenient for different domestic time zones

Provide enlightened hospitality to create lasting connections with prospective students, families and school counseling staff.

Work with others to support division-wide enrollment initiatives such as event planning, program management, communication flow, and other duties as assigned.

Qualifications:

Bachelors degree, required

This position includes seasonal travel within an assigned territory, along with occasional evening and weekend recruitment events planned in advance

Dynamic public speaker with excellent writing and interpersonal skills

Ability to work independently and collaboratively as a goal-oriented strategic thinker

Intercultural competence and the ability to work with diverse populations

Must have a valid driver's license and evidence of insurability

Must be able to lift and carry 30 pounds, reach above shoulders, bend at the waist, stand for extended periods of time.

About Illinois College:

Illinois College is a residential, private liberal arts college located in the heart of Illinois, 70 miles northeast of Saint Louis, Missouri, and 30 miles west of Springfield, the capital of Illinois. True to its founding vision in 1829, Illinois College is a community committed to the highest standards of scholarship and integrity in the liberal arts. The College develops in its students qualities of mind and character needed for fulfilling lives of leadership and service, fostering academic excellence rooted in opportunities for experiential learning while preparing students for lifelong success.
